The Massage Roller System

The roller arms and massage roller track comprise the massage roller system. Because the roller track in most massage chairs is fixed, the rollers can only move in a straight line up and down your back. Curved roller tracks are present in certain massage chairs, though. With this adjustment, the rollers now travel up and down your back while following the curve of your spine.

The L-track and S-track are the two most popular varieties of roller tracks. The S-track, which just goes from the neck to the upper back, is the most popular kind of track in massage chairs. The L-track is a lengthy roller track that extends from the nape to the buttocks and lower back. This type of massage track is growing in popularity because of the deeper treatment it offers.

If you're searching for a massage chair with a stretching feature, the L-Track model is a more suitable option. If you want full-body coverage, an L-Track is your best bet. However, if you're looking for a more intense massage, an S-Track might be all you need. If you're experiencing lower back pain, an L-Track would be a better option because it will cover this area more extensively.

2D vs 3D vs 4D Rollers

The goal of all three types of massage rollers—2D, 3D, and 4D—is to offer a deep tissue massage, but there are some significant differences between them. A 2D roller that massages up and down has two rows of rotating balls organized in it. 3D rollers with three rows of revolving balls massage in two planes: up and down and side to side. Four rows of rotating balls are used by 4D rollers to massage in two directions: up and down and side to side.

Receiving a 2D back roller massage is a great approach to improve your natural health and lower stress. For the lower back, 2D massage rollers are a terrific way to ease discomfort and strained muscles. The 3D massage feels far more organic than the traditional 2-dimensional technique. To increase the intensity, the rollers can move in all directions and even push outward. With 3D massage technology, the rollers may reach regions that regular chairs miss by extending farther off their track.

The speed is the fourth dimension of the 4D massage roller technology. The rollers in a 4D massage will automatically speed up or slow down to target your tense muscles, so you won't need to utilize a remote control to modify any settings. A massage from a licensed professional therapist can be more closely replicated by the 4D massage chair.

Dual vs. Quad Rollers

If you want a simple, reasonably priced massage chair, your best bet is a dual roller system. Since dual rollers are often easier to make and smaller and less complex than quad rollers, you'll find them on less costly chairs. Moreover, thorough massages with two rollers are often unsuccessful.

If you want the greatest massage possible, you have to buy a quad roller system. Quad rollers provide a more powerful and thorough massage, despite their higher cost. They have four different rollers that can be adjusted to provide a customized massage and can target different back regions.
